Set in the 18th century, this novel explores themes of identity, morality, and the supernatural through the story of a man named St. Leon, who grapples with the consequences of a mysterious pact that grants him immortality. As he navigates a world filled with intrigue and philosophical dilemmas, St. Leon's journey raises profound questions about the nature of existence and the human condition. Godwin's work combines elements of gothic fiction with deep philosophical inquiry, making it a thought-provoking read.
